BENEFIT WATT’S UP DUPE

Watt’s Up is probably one of Benefit’s better known products and despite not being a huge fan of the entire packaging, I’ve always loved the product. It’s a wind up, roll on highlighter that instantly adds light and glow to the skin. The slightly golden, moonshine highlight is really flattering on the skin and blends in well over foundation. It’s a winner in terms of performance, but at £24.50 it’s very pricey. 

On a recent browse in Boots I came across the No.7 stand, one I don’t visit often enough. Alongside their new Pop & Glow Cheek Pops sat the Instant Radiance Highlighter for £9.95. No, it’s not cheap but compared to £24.50 it’s a lot more affordable. After a couple of weeks testing I’m here to report back and it’s good news. 

Similar to Watt’s Up (minus the strange foam buffer) it’s a wind up product that can be applied directly onto the skin. Instead of being flat headed, the product is actually rounded which I found made application much easier. The product shows up very visibly, but is also easy to blend into the skin which is just how I like it. Compared to Watt’s Up it’s slightly more champagne and less gold, but both give that gorgeous moonshine highlight. I’ve loved wearing this recently and the packaging is so handy for when you’re in a rush or on the go. 

If’ Watt’s Up has always been on your wish list I’d stop saving and skip straight to the No.7 Instant Radiance… it does the job just as well!
